When it comes to recording Twitch.tv streams on different platforms, users can use dedicated software designed for both Mac and Windows systems. Common options are OBS Studio, Streamlabs OBS, and Bandicam, each offering a range of features from adjustable settings to streamlined interfaces. With proper setup, these tools can produce high quality Twitch.tv videos that meet your requirements for quality and bitrate, making them perfect for archiving or modifying.

When it involves storing Twitch VODs and clips, selecting the appropriate video format can influence your disk space and organization plan. MP4 and MKV are popular formats that provide a decent balance of resolution and storage space. Lawful and Ethical Factors

When capturing or downloading Twitch material, it is essential to navigate the legal landscape cautiously. Twitch streamers maintain entitlements over their initial transmissions, and illegitimate dissemination or commercialization of their content can lead to legal disputes. Understanding intellectual property laws and the fair use doctrine is crucial for anyone looking to store or distribute Twitch broadcasts, as these rules dictate how material can be used without violating on the entitlements of authors. It is recommended to seek clear permission from the content creator before using their production for purposes beyond personal enjoyment.
